Week 15 Grade: Indianapolis Colts Offense vs Denver Broncos

Indianapolis picked off Trevor Siemian on Denver’s first drive, and the offense made the most of it going 50 yards in seven plays. Jacoby Brissett capped off the drive with a touchdown scramble putting the Colts up 7-0.

After punting on their second drive, the offense put together another 50+ yard drive that ended with a field goal. Unfortunately, the Colts would only go on to score three more points for the entire game as they were suffocated by Denver’s defense.

Outside of those first three drives, the Colts only gained 97 yards on offense. They left their defense out to dry as they were unable to sustain any drives to keep Brock Osweiler and the Broncos’ offense off the field.
